- The distance between Matam, Senegal and Huambo, Angola is approximately 4,491 km or 2,791 mi.
- To reach Matam in this distance one would set out from Huambo bearing 313.9°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Matam bearing 313.1° or NW .
- Matam has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Huambo has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b).
- Matam is in or near the tropical very dry forest biome whereas Huambo is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 10.7 °C (19.3°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.2 °C (11.2°F) more in Matam.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1032.2 mm (40.6 in) less which is equivalent to 1032.2 l/m² (25.33 US gal/ft²) or 10,322,000 l/ha (1,103,490 US gal/ac) less. About 1/4 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.4° lower in Matam than in Huambo.
